PRE- DEPARTUREDAY
If you travel from Hanoi or other destinations. You will travel on the van or bus in the afternoon or night sleeper bus, check-in our hotel in Ha Giang City for the night before starting the adventure on Day 1.
DAY 1: HA GIANG – QUAN BA – YEN MINH – DONG VAN (140 KM) (B,L,D)
Meetup: At our cafe or we pick you up from your hotel at 8:00 am, then take the mountain roads to Quan Ba town, you will enjoy the incredible view of the Happy road below.
On the way you can take some photos with the magnificent view of the rice fields, mountains and valleys. In the villages, you can experience the culture and customs of the Red Dao people in Nam Dam Village. There, you will have the opportunity to talk to the local people to learn about their way of life, culture, and customs. We will continue our journey to Yen Minh where we will have lunch. After lunch, we will continue our journey to more distant villages. From there, you will know how people live in more remote parts of Vietnam. We will drive through the villages of Lung Cam, Sa Phin. A stop will be made en route to visit a H’mong Village in Lung Cam, and the residence of the Vuong Family, still called “Palace of Hmong King or Opium King’s place”. After checking in our hotel in Dong Van, dinner will again include lots of happy water if you are of drinking age and wish to partake.
We highly recommend planning your trip to pass through Dong Van on Sunday, when the villagers host their weekly highland market. It’s not only a chance for locals to buy and sell goods and livestock but it’s highly anticipated as a weekly social gathering.
DAY 2: DONG VAN – MA PI LENG PASS – MEO VAC – MAU DUE – DU GIA (B,L,D)
After breakfast, we will go to Ma Pi Leng pass highlight of the trip the most impresive mountain pass in Vietnam. We will trekking in Sky Path to “top views’’ there is pictureques panorama of Ma Pi Leng Pass. We’ll stop in Mau Due for lunch. After lunch we will continue drive to Sa Li pass through Lung Ho village. You’ll see many of the minority children playing by the side of the road while their parents are working alongside the rocks. We’ll go to Du Gia the village located in the midle of the rice fields where we stay over night.
DAY 3: DU GIA WATERFALL – LUNG TAM – HA GIANG (B,L)
After breakfast, we will go to hidden waterfall where you can swim before we continue our way to Lung Tam Village. In this village of the H’mong minority, we will learn how to make fabrics from locally grown hemp in Northwest Vietnam. We will have a delicious lunch in one of the local restaurant. After croosing Haven Gate, Pac Sum pass back to Ha Giang. and arrive back in Ha Giang by 4 pm for dropping you off at your hotel.
